INDUSTRIAL CONFERENCE SETTLES TO WORK

PEACE IN’ INDUSTRY MOVE. (Received 9.50 a.m.) MELBOURNE, This Day. The Peace in Industry Conference has settled down to work. Sir Arthur Duckham and Sir Hugo Hirst, two of the big four, wer© again present and gave addresses.—Australian Press Assn.
